Binomial filters

Binomial filters are simple and efficient structures based on the binomial coefficients for implementing Gaussian filtering. They do not require multipliers and can therefore be implemented efficiently in programmable hardware. Design and responses of Butterworth and critically damped digital filters.

For many years the Butterworth lowpass filter has been used to smooth many kinds of biomechanical data, despite the fact that it is underdamped and therefore overshoots and/or undershoots data during rapid transitions. Direct design of optimal filters from data

In the literature on filter design, the system whose state has to be estimated is usually assumed known. However, in most practical situations, this assumption does not hold, and a two-step procedure is adopted: 1) a model is identified from a set of noise-corrupted data; 2) on the basis of the identified model, a Kalman filter is designed. Optimal Design of Fractional Delay Filters

Fractional delay filters are those that are designed to delay the input signals by a fractional amount of the sampling time. They are widely used in digital communications, speech processing, digital modeling of musical instruments, etc. Since the delay is fractional, the intersample behavior of input signals become crucial.
